Located in the picturesque Trossachs National Park, you can expect incredible natural surrounds at this Go Ape Aberfoyle.
With a stunning backdrop of mountain and moorland, forest and woodland, rivers and lochs – this dual course really is zip wire heaven!
Home to two of the longest zips in the UK you’ll be flying over trees and waterfalls with unprecedented, seasonal views of the hills, valleys and Highlands.
The start of this Treetop Challenge packs a punch with a colossal 323-metre zip thrill before you’ve even tackled the high-rise challenges. Your reward? A whopping 45-metre-high, 426-metre-long flight back down to earth.
Treetop Challenge
This dual high ropes course is not for the faint-hearted. With a choice of route – one more challenging than the other, and one of the UK’s longest zip wires, stretching over 400 metres, you will not be disappointed! The combination of extreme Stirrups, wobbling Stack Line challenge and teetering Half Trapeze are all great preparation for the over 10s looking for the ultimate experience. Take in unprecedented views of the stunning Trossachs National Park, as you zip over trees and a free-falling waterfall. It doesn’t get much better than this!
Zip Line Experience
A zip line experience that includes two huge zip wire rides through the Trossachs National Park in the Scottish Highlands.
On your zip wire journeys across the valley, you’ll soar over a waterfall and fly above the pines for a combined 750 metres of adrenaline-fuelled fun!
